Master of Arts (M.A.)

An interdisciplinary postgraduate program in English and Communication Studies

Program Overview

IACER's Master of Arts program is an interdisciplinary postgraduate degree that incorporates study of literature and cultural discourses. Students are oriented towards both English Studies and the study of various cultural themes including Race, Ethnicity, Class, Nation, Gender, and Conflict.

The program is designed for graduates who wish to deepen their understanding of the humanities, develop advanced research and writing skills, and engage with contemporary critical theory.

M.A. graduates often go on to Ph.D. programs or pursue careers in education, research, journalism, and the development sector.

Course Structure

Semester 1 – Literary Foundations
  • Introduction to Literary Theory
  • British Literature: Modernism and After
  • Writing Workshop: Academic Writing and Argumentation
  • Language and Society: Sociolinguistics
Semester 2 – Cultural Studies
  • Cultural Studies: Race, Class, Gender, Nation
  • American Literature and Culture
  • Postcolonial Theory and Literature
  • Writing through the Labyrinth: Gothic Fiction
Semester 3 – Advanced Research
  • Research Methodology in Humanities
  • South Asian Literature and Diaspora
  • Feminist Theory and Women's Writing
  • Discourse Analysis and Critical Linguistics
Semester 4 – Thesis & Specialization
  • Master's Thesis / Dissertation
  • Elective: Media and Communication Studies
  • Elective: Translation and Comparative Literature
  • Advanced Seminar in Literary Criticism
